Transaction 64fd628e89f66ecf3498ad0491bf730c38b126723ddad53757ef03e10f760116
1 Input
1 Output
-
64fd628e89f66ecf3498ad0491bf730c38b126723ddad53757ef03e10f760116:0
- value
- 148640
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3b5fddf93c265216817f48f9fb902c6f0a0d922 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FvdAGpt2ZwkjAhYuPebwRc6SZVhNgQGqp